Mia Clinica 7% Glycolic Acid Toner is a water toner used as the first step after face cleansing. The low-viscosity formula spreads without a heavy feel and smoothly conditions the skin texture. It helps reduce the burden of irritation and allows for a comfortable transition to the next step of absorption.
